Elli J. Glist née Sperling, age 94, beloved wife of the late Norman Glist, passed away peacefully on Feb. 12, 2021. Elli was preceded in death by her parents Adolf and Blanche Sperling; she was a cherished sister to Litzi (Harold) Marsh, loving mother of Sherri (Frank) Mariani and Catherine Glist (Murray); devoted Nana of Francis V Mariani, Alexandra (John) Johnson, Michael (Kathryn) Mastrangelo Jr, James (Brittany) Mastrangelo, and Jake Mastrangelo; doting Nana of Joseph Johnson and Anthony Johnson, caring Gigi of Clark Mastrangelo, Mackenzie Mastrangelo, Abigail Mastrangelo, Benjamin Mastrangelo, Francesca Mastrangelo, and Jack Mastrangelo, and fond Aunt to many nieces and pephews. Born in Vienna, Austria in 1926; Elli, Litzi, and their parents came to the US in 1940. After attending Highland Park High School, she went to the University of Illinois where she met her true love, Norman Glist. After marriage they lived a wonderful life in Deerfield, IL where they raised their daughters, Sherri and Catherine. Elli and Norm enjoyed traveling the world, where she loved to photograph the people and places they visited. Elli continued to hone her photography skills by participating competitively in several camera clubs. She was legendary for her pies and her years of community involvement and service. However, what brought her true joy was her family.Service Information
